    Michael e Debi Pearl sono autori dediti al ministero della scrittura sull'educazione dei figli e sulle relazioni familiari, considerandolo l'opera e la vocazione della loro vita. Il loro approccio è profondamente radicato nei principi cristiani, con l'obiettivo di guidare i genitori nell'educazione dei figli secondo i fondamenti biblici. Attraverso i loro scritti e i loro ministeri in corso, cercano di promuovere strutture familiari forti e basate sulla fede, nonché relazioni sane. La loro vasta esperienza nell'evangelizzazione, nel ministero pastorale e nel servizio alla comunità informa la loro guida pratica e spiritualmente fondata.

      A huge success in its original black and white format, Good and Evil has been reprinted larger and exquisitely colorized. Good and Evil is Gods redemption plan told chronologically from Genesis to Revelation. The 324-page book written by Michael Pearl and illustrated by Danny Bulanadi, former of Marvel Comics (Incredible Hulk), resembles an oversized comic book. Good and Evil begins where God began, in the book of Genesis, with the Creator, the fall of man, the law, blood sacrifice, and the prophecies of the coming Redeemer, thus preparing the people to fully understand the gospel of Christ. Good and Evil captivates those who would not normally pick up a Bible. In addition to the color art, each page footnotes Scriptural passages for further Bible study. Young and old, teens, prisoners, military personnel, and Christian workers have testified to the incredible impact Good and Evil has made on their understanding of the Bible.

      Exploring Biblical texts, the author reveals God's intention for marriage as a celebration of erotic pleasure, challenging societal taboos surrounding sexuality. Drawing inspiration from The Song of Solomon, the book encourages readers to reclaim the conversation about sex, positioning it as a divine gift rather than a topic shrouded in shame. Pearl's insights aim to transform perceptions of intimacy within the sacred bond of marriage.
